In this conversation, Sonia Houria Rivas speaks with Veronica Robin, founder of The Loop Kitchen, about building a sustainable meal delivery service rooted in reuse, community, and conscious choice. They explore the environmental and health impacts of plastic, why reducing waste starts with everyday decisions, and how food systems shape both wellbeing and connection.
Veronica shares her personal journey toward sustainable living, the two-year process behind launching The Loop Kitchen, and the challenges of building a mission-driven business while navigating uncertainty and self-doubt. Together, they discuss practical ways to reduce food waste, the importance of flexibility and rest, and how small, consistent changes - made with awareness rather than perfection - can create meaningful impact over time.
